19. A mass of gas has a volume of 4 m3, a temperature of 290 K, and an absolute pressure of 475 kPa. When the gas is allowed to
Aleks [24]

Recall this gas law:

\frac{P₁V₁}{T₁} = \frac{P₂V}{T₂}

P₁ and P₂ are the initial and final pressures.

V₁ and V₂ are the initial and final volumes.

T₁ and T₂ are the initial and final temperatures.

Given values:

P₁ = 475kPa

V₁ = 4m³, V₂ = 6.5m³

T₁ = 290K, T₂ = 277K

Substitute the terms in the equation with the given values and solve for Pf:

\frac{475*4}{290} = \frac{P₂*6.5}{277}

<h3>P₂ = 279.2kPa</h3>

A force of magnitude 33.73 lb directed toward the right is exerted on an object. What other force must be applied to the object
vova2212 [387]

Answer:

33.73 lb to the left

Explanation:

You need to exert a force with the same magnitude, but opposite direction. You can visualize it in this way: When you push an object, the object will follow your path, but if there is another person opposing the force you are exerting, the object will just not move. If the force that the other person exerts were higher, then the object would move in the opposite direction. So, you need them to have the same magnitude.
